The video discusses the significant financial losses experienced by the wealthy, including LVMH chairman Bernard Arnault and Jeff Bezos, due to the pandemic and falling oil prices. It highlights the end of a decade of soaring stocks and cheap funding. The video also explores how the wealthy reacted, with increased demand for private jets, canceled charity events, and retreats to secluded homes.
